We were pleased to welcome a delegation from Lloyds Banking Group to Aston University Engineering Academy on Tuesday 20 January.
The group had the opportunity to visit the UTC’s top-of-the-range facilities and meet students who are preparing for high-skilled technical careers in a range of sectors.
The visit took in the UTC’s health suite, which closely simulates a modern hospital ward and features lifelike mannequins.
